略微加速

PHP官方手册 - 互联网笔记

PHP - Manual: imap_utf7_encode

2025-02-27

imap_utf7_encode

(PHP 4, PHP 5, PHP 7, PHP 8)

imap_utf7_encodeConverts ISO-8859-1 string to modified UTF-7 text

说明

imap_utf7_encode(string $string): string

Converts string to modified UTF-7 text.

This is needed to encode mailbox names that contain certain characters which are not in range of printable ASCII characters.

参数

string

An ISO-8859-1 string.

返回值

Returns string encoded with the modified UTF-7 encoding as defined in » RFC 2060, section 5.1.3.

参见

添加备注

用户贡献的备注 1 note

up
0
Olivier
6 years ago
For those who search for a good implementation of modified UTF-7 encoding for IMAP, you can find a code that works on :
http://tananyag.ntszki.hu/mail/functions/imap_utf7_local.php
The result is different from imap-utf7-encode() function and is identical to mailbox name generated by Thunderbird.

官方地址:https://www.php.net/manual/en/function.imap-utf7-encode.php

北京半月雨文化科技有限公司.版权所有 京ICP备12026184号-3